Understanding Lean Coaching
Lean Coaching is a collaborative approach that draws inspiration from the principles of Lean manufacturing. It focuses on creating a culture of continuous improvement, empowering individuals and teams to identify and eliminate waste, and optimizing processes to deliver exceptional results.
At the heart of Lean Coaching lies the belief that every member of the team possesses valuable knowledge and insights. By fostering a culture of open dialogue and continuous learning, Lean Coaching empowers teams to tap into their collective expertise and drive innovation.
Key Principles of Lean Coaching
- Focus on value: Identify and prioritize activities that add value to the team and eliminate those that do not.
- Continuous improvement: Create a culture where individuals and teams are constantly seeking ways to enhance processes and outcomes.
- Respect for people: Value the contributions of all team members and foster an environment of psychological safety.
- Collaboration: Encourage teamwork, open communication, and knowledge sharing among team members.
- Data-driven decision-making: Utilize data to inform decisions and measure the effectiveness of improvement initiatives.

Tools and Techniques for Lean Coaching
The Lean Coaching Workbook is packed with practical tools and techniques to support the coaching process. These include:
- 5 Whys: A powerful technique for uncovering the root causes of problems.
- Value Stream Mapping: A visual representation of a process that helps identify waste and inefficiencies.
- Kanban: A visual project management tool that promotes collaboration and transparency.
- Retrospectives: Regular team meetings to reflect on progress, identify areas for improvement, and build a shared understanding.
- Coaching Questions: Thought-provoking questions designed to facilitate self-reflection and growth.
